技能 using-superpowers
📦

using-superpowers

安全

回應前務必先呼叫技能

也可從以下取得: DYAI2025,davila7,Cygnusfear,Cycleaddict,CodingCossack,obra

這個後設技能建立了關鍵的工作流程紀律,要求 Claude Code 在任何回應或行動前先檢查並呼叫相關技能,避免遺漏機會和合理化行為。

支援: Claude Codex Code(CC)
🥉 73 青銅
1

下載技能 ZIP

2

在 Claude 中上傳

前往 設定 → 功能 → 技能 → 上傳技能

3

開啟並開始使用

測試它

正在使用「using-superpowers」。 使用者詢問:幫我寫一個 Python 腳本

預期結果:

  • 我注意到你想要我寫程式碼。首先,讓我使用 using-superpowers 方法檢查相關技能。在繼續之前,我會呼叫技能工具來尋找與程式碼編寫相關的技能。

正在使用「using-superpowers」。 使用者詢問:除錯我的 React 應用程式中的這個錯誤

預期結果:

  • 在投入除錯之前,我應該檢查技能。根據 using-superpowers 工作流程,我會呼叫技能工具來看看是否適用除錯或 React 特定技能。

正在使用「using-superpowers」。 使用者說:讓我先探索程式碼庫

預期結果:

  • 根據 using-superpowers,這個想法是紅旗 - 「讓我先探索程式碼庫」意味著我在合理化。技能告訴我如何探索。讓我先檢查相關技能。

安全審計

安全
v1 • 2/24/2026

All four static findings are false positives. The detected patterns (Ruby/shell backticks and weak cryptographic algorithms) are Markdown formatting syntax (backticks for code spans and code blocks) and do not represent actual security risks. This is a pure documentation skill containing workflow guidance.

1
已掃描檔案
88
分析行數
2
發現項
1
審計總數
中風險問題 (1)
False Positive: External Commands Pattern
Scanner detected Ruby/shell backtick execution at SKILL.md:16 and SKILL.md:26, but these are Markdown backticks for code formatting (the Skill tool name and DOT diagram syntax), not actual shell commands. This is a documentation file with no executable code. Confidence: 0.95 - The backticks are Markdown syntax for code formatting, not shell execution operators.
低風險問題 (1)
False Positive: Weak Cryptographic Algorithm
Scanner flagged lines 3 and 72 as containing weak cryptographic algorithms. This appears to be pattern matching confusion - line 3 contains YAML frontmatter description, line 72 contains Implementation skills. No cryptographic operations exist in this file. Confidence: 0.98 - The scanner appears to have confused text patterns.
審計者: claude

品質評分

38
架構
100
可維護性
85
內容
50
社群
98
安全
91
規範符合性

你能建構什麼

新對話啟動器

在任何新對話開始時,呼叫此技能以在嘗試任何任務前建立工作流程紀律

技能驗證輔助工具

當不確定技能是否適用於當前任務時使用 - 此技能強制檢查而非假設

工作流程刷新器

在長對話期間定期呼叫,以便在工作流程鬆懈時重新建立紀律

試試這些提示

基本技能檢查
在回應以下內容前,我應該呼叫任何技能嗎:[描述你的任務]?
技能優先順序檢查
哪些技能可能適用於此任務?根據 using-superpowers 技能按優先順序列出。
合理化偵測
我是否在合理化自己不檢查技能?對照 using-superpowers 中的這些紅旗:[技能中的清單]
複雜任務技能規劃
對於此複雜任務,識別:1) 決定方法的流程技能,2) 指導執行的實作技能。根據 using-superpowers,順序很重要。

最佳實務

  • 在每次對話開始時、任何回應之前呼叫此技能
  • 即使只有 1% 的技能適用可能性,也應作為呼叫技能工具的理由
  • 每次重新閱讀技能內容 - 技能會隨著時間演變
  • 永遠不要合理化自己不檢查技能 - 使用紅旗清單

避免

  • 在未先檢查相關技能的情況下回應簡單問題
  • 在檢查技能告訴你如何探索之前就探索程式碼庫
  • 假設自己記得技能而跳過實際呼叫
  • 認為任務太簡單而不需要呼叫技能

常見問題

此技能是否適用於所有 Claude Code 版本?
是的,這是一個提供工作流程指導的文件技能。它教導技能呼叫原則,適用於所有版本的 Claude Code。
我需要每次手動呼叫此技能嗎?
是的,這個後設技能必須在對話開始時呼叫。它建立在任何回應前檢查其他技能的紀律。
如果技能與我的任務無關怎麼辦?
如果呼叫的技能結果不適合當前情況,你不需要使用它。技能檢查仍然是有價值的紀律。
這與一般技能有何不同?
這是一個指導工作流程行為的後設技能。與特定任務技能不同,它不執行動作,而是教導正確的技能呼叫紀律。
此技能會與其他技能衝突嗎?
不會,它與其他技能並行運作。根據此技能中的指導,流程技能(如 headstorming)應先呼叫,然後是實作技能。
如果我忘記呼叫此技能怎麼辦?
如果你意識到自己跳過了技能檢查,你可以回溯呼叫它。此技能中的紅旗幫助你識別何時一直在合理化。

開發者詳情

檔案結構

📄 SKILL.md